Intel’s Answer to AMD X3D Leaked: Nova Lake “bLLC” CPUs Pack Up To 38% More Cache Than Ryzen 9950X3D2

Jaykihn discloses cache details of five SKUs, which were already covered in a previous article. These include two SKUs with dual compute tiles and three SKUs with single compute tiles. The SKUs along with their maximum caches are listed below:

Core Ultra X (52 Cores) - 288 MB

Core Ultra X (44 Cores) - 264 MB

Core Ultra 9 (28 Cores) - 144 MB

Core Ultra 7 (24 Cores) - 132 MB

Core Ultra 9 (22 Cores) - 108 MB

The dual compute tile SKUs will be Intel's answer to AMD's dual 3D V-Cache models, such as the Ryzen 9 9950X3D2, which is launching next week with 208 MB of cache. The 264 MB Nova Lake SKU will offer 27% more cache, while the 288 MB Nova Lake SKU will offer 38% more cache. AMD is also likely to pack more cache in its future X3D CPUs, so it looks like we are going to see some insane cache counts on consumer desktop platforms from both camps.
